aboutsummaryrefslogtreecommitdiffstats
path: root/src/libs
diff options
context:
space:
mode:
authorTobias Hunger <tobias.hunger@qt.io>2020-03-02 10:45:42 +0100
committerTim Jenssen <tim.jenssen@qt.io>2020-03-03 16:01:53 +0000
commitb5ba4dcb16381b7ecea92f5f60fa13853a2ebca3 (patch)
treeb42a2ae8accdfec0d239a9d7dce1f1d2a451d857 /src/libs
parent95182dc6b9ca34565228794d1a939494575f085a (diff)
ADS: Properly initialize DockManager
Change-Id: I2728c6d7dd6db736be14efc71a5ab62efc40d6ee Reviewed-by: Tim Jenssen <tim.jenssen@qt.io>
Diffstat (limited to 'src/libs')
-rw-r--r--src/libs/advanceddockingsystem/dockmanager.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/libs/advanceddockingsystem/dockmanager.cpp b/src/libs/advanceddockingsystem/dockmanager.cpp
index 768003d44a..63c71c7a8a 100644
--- a/src/libs/advanceddockingsystem/dockmanager.cpp
+++ b/src/libs/advanceddockingsystem/dockmanager.cpp
@@ -83,8 +83,8 @@ namespace ADS
DockManager *q;
QList<FloatingDockContainer *> m_floatingWidgets;
QList<DockContainerWidget *> m_containers;
- DockOverlay *m_containerOverlay;
- DockOverlay *m_dockAreaOverlay;
+ DockOverlay *m_containerOverlay = nullptr;
+ DockOverlay *m_dockAreaOverlay = nullptr;
QMap<QString, DockWidget *> m_dockWidgetsMap;
bool m_restoringState = false;
QVector<FloatingDockContainer *> m_uninitializedFloatingWidgets;
@@ -95,7 +95,7 @@ namespace ADS
QHash<QString, QDateTime> m_workspaceDateTimes;
QString m_workspaceToRestoreAtStartup;
bool m_autorestoreLastWorkspace; // This option is set in the Workspace Manager!
- QSettings *m_settings;
+ QSettings *m_settings = nullptr;
/**
* Private data constructor